I am not really sure how to classify this book. It is a Paranormal with religious undertones but it also has premarital sex. I am have no problem with that, but traditionally somebody looking for a Christian read doesn't want sex and regular paranormal readers are not looking for as much god talk. This makes it difficult to see exactly who the target audience is.
I generally like the book and the story. There is a great flow to the book and the characters. I did think it was a bit tricky all coming from Kendra's POV, it limits you to only what she knows or is told. It might have been nice to have a little of Adam and his skepticism. Or Ryan, with his guardian angel angst.
Kendra has moments of immaturity and times when she seems really promiscuous. Not sure how a Christian readers are going to take her friends-with-benefits relationship. It also appears almost every guy in the book is interested in her. Don't get me wrong, she has some really winning moments, but there are a lot of curve balls as well.
I listened to the audiobook narrated by Erin Mallon, who does a very nice job of helping to connect with the main character. Her voice is rather breathy at times, but nothing I could not handle. She has a steady quick pace, another thing I enjoy. Her voices were all distinct and consistent throughout. The emotions seemed off at times, some moments were dropped while others seemed exaggerated. Still it was a comfortable listen.
